In a recent conversation, actress Surveen Chawla shared an insight about introducing menstruation to her 3-year-old daughter. She stressed the significance of using accurate terminology from the start, explaining that her daughter is accustomed to calling the female genitalia ‘v*gina’, as this has been what she’s always been taught to use.

In a noteworthy conversation with Hauterrfly, I, too, have recently revealed that my child has been sensitively educated about menstruation at an age-suitable level. One day, she unexpectedly ventured into my bathroom, opened a drawer and discovered a pack of sanitary pads hidden within.

The young girl inquired about the subject to the actress who stars on Criminal Justice Season 4, and she received a clear explanation in response. Surveen explained that during this period, women expel ‘impure fluid’ from their body, which is similar to an adult diaper being used for absorption with sanitary pads.

In moments of unease, she informs her daughter that she’s experiencing menstrual cramps and requests a bit of privacy instead.

Additionally, Surveen Chawla mentioned that she started discussing menstruation with her child when she was just three years old. She believes that the first introduction of a topic can have a long-term impact, which is why it’s crucial to make such discussions commonplace from an early age.

She added, “She knows what a v*gina is because that’s all I’ve called it.”

Currently, in her professional life, Surveen Chawla has made an appearance in the hotly anticipated Criminal Justice Season 4. This series is headlined by Pankaj Tripathi, who returns to portray the shrewd and non-traditional lawyer Madhav Mishra. In this new captivating case, his legal skills are put to the test yet again.

In this new season of “Criminal Justice,” based on the highly praised British show with the same title, we delve into another gripping courtroom story. This time, the narrative revolves around a solitary murder case, two primary suspects, and an intricate family dynamic that lies at its core.

Alongside Pankaj and Surveen, the show additionally features Mohammed Zeeshan Ayyub, Asha Negi, Barkha Singh, Shweta Basu Prasad, and Khushboo Atree.

At present, Surveen Chawla’s performance can be watched on JioHotstar, where she portrays the character of Raj Nagpal’s wife, who becomes embroiled in a courtroom struggle.
